The 1881 Census reveals a detailed snapshot of households in England, Wales and Scotland. The census was taken on April 3rd and the total population was recorded as 29,707,207.

In the 1881 Census, the household of Hannah Normand, born in 1806 in Sheffield, Yorkshire, consisted of 2 members. Hannah was the head of the household, widow.
During the period, also present in the household was Hannah's Lodger, Sarah Hogden, born in 1826 in Sheffield, Yorkshire, England.
